Nominated 0 Times in 0 Posts TOTW/F/M Award(s): 0 | Hello to all, We are currently 3 months behind on our mortgage due to reduced income. We had Countrywide call us a couple weeks ago requesting we fax over hardship letter and 2 pay stubs to see if we qualify for President Obama's new plan. However, I believe that our loan is owned by Bank of New York and not by Freddie Mac or Fannie Mae. Other than this issue, we fit all the other criteria. Do we have any chance to qualify for the new program if our loan is not owed by Freddie Mac or Fannie Mae?????? |

The freddie/fannie restriction only applies to the refinance portion of program, participation in the modification portion is voluntary but Countrywide a/k/a Bank of america has agreed to participate here is some links about the new program Countrywide Financial - Real Estate Mortgage Lender - Home Loans - Equity Loan Mortgages http://www.treas.gov/press/releases/...guidelines.pdf http://www.treas.gov/press/releases/...es_summary.pdf |

Rumor, Have you checked your County Recorder's on-line site to see if a Notice of Default has been recorded yet ? In CA, if one has been recorded, you have 3 mos and 21 days until Trustee sale. If a NOD has not been recorded, you have longer. I would check that site regularly. Unfortunately, what goes on is one dept. purports to be assisting w/ a mod while another is moving forward with a foreclosure. Crazymaking. Familiarize yourself with your state's foreclosure timeframes/laws. |

Nominated 0 Times in 0 Posts TOTW/F/M Award(s): 0 | Re: Field agent confirming occupancy?????? Ask the agent for ID and get their card. Nobody should be knocking on your door as an agent for your lender and not present some sort of ID. Unfortunately, there are unscrupulous people out there that are out for themselves. I have heard of this tactic used by investors, realtors wanting your business, process servers, and of course gypsy scammers in the past. If you read the Fannie Mae guidelines for the Obama plan, it says they confirm residency from such things as a copy of your drivers license, utility bills, and copy of tax return etc. I went 8 months without making payments, never had anyone knock on my door until they process server hit us with the foreclosure papers. I know we were getting charged a monthly fee by Countrywide for an occupancy check of some-sort, but I assume it was a drive-by check by an area realtor to make sure the house was still occupied and not abandoned. |
